As organizations face an increasingly complex digital landscape, the importance of robust backup and disaster recovery (BDCR) strategies cannot be overstated. Recent research, which surveyed over 3,000 IT professionals globally, highlights emerging trends and persistent challenges that businesses will encounter in 2025.
One significant trend is the growing reliance on cloud solutions for data storage and recovery. As more companies transition to hybrid and multi-cloud environments, the need for seamless integration and interoperability becomes crucial. Additionally, advancements in automation and artificial intelligence are reshaping how organizations approach disaster recovery, enabling faster response times and minimizing downtime.
However, with these advancements come challenges. Cybersecurity threats continue to evolve, making data protection more critical than ever. Organizations must also navigate regulatory compliance and ensure that their BCDR plans are aligned with industry standards. As businesses prepare for the future, addressing these trends and challenges will be essential for maintaining continuity and resilience in an unpredictable world.
